AUDITFILELAYOUT
Use this parameter to control the layout format of the audit file. In particular, this parameter can be used to enable
writing audit in CSV (comma separated values) format for easy subsequent processing in other tools like Excel, SQL,
etc..
Parameter Syntax
AUDITFILELAYOUT layout
Arguments
layout
must be one of
• ORIGINAL - original pipe symbol separated audit format.
• CSV - comma separated values format (NonStop SSL AAI and higher).
Default
By default, AUDITFILELAYOUT will be set to CSV.
AUDITFILERETENTION
Use this parameter to control how many audit files HP NonStop SSL keeps when audit file rollover occurs.
Parameter Syntax
AUDITFILERETENTION n
Arguments
n
number of audit files to keep
Default
By default, 10 files are kept.
Considerations
• a minimum of 10 is enforced for that parameter
• See "Logfile/Auditfile Rollover" in chapter "Monitoring
" for details on logfile rollover.
